1. Significance of Downpipes
Downpipes play a crucial function in protecting a residential or commercial property from water damage. Without correct drainage, water can overflow and collect around the foundation, resulting in severe structural problems with time. Here are some reasons keeping downpipes is essential:
| Importance | Information |
|---|---|
| Avoid Water Damage | Helps redirect rainwater far from the foundation. |
| Avoid Mold Growth | Avoids excess moisture, which can result in mold problem. |
| Protect Aesthetic | Keeps the outside of the building looking clean and kept. |
| Increase Lifespan | Routine upkeep can extend the life of your downpipes. |
| Affordable | Early detection of concerns can prevent expensive repair work. |
2. Common Problems with Downpipes
Gradually, downpipes can come across various problems that can compromise their efficiency. Here are some typical problems and their causes:
| Problem | Causes |
|---|---|
| Blockages | Leaves, dirt, particles, and obstructions. |
| Leakages | Cracks or holes in the pipe product. |
| Corrosion | Metal downpipes can rust gradually. |
| Inappropriate Installation | Poor design or installation strategies. |
| Structural Damage | Shifts in the building's foundation. |
3. Upkeep Checklist
Regular maintenance can significantly minimize the likelihood of problems. Here's a detailed list for downpipe maintenance:
| Maintenance Task | Frequency |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Visual Inspection | Regular monthly | Look for visible fractures or drooping. |
| Clean Gutters | At least bi-annually | Avoid particles from accumulating. |
| Clear Downpipes | Every year | Utilize a plumber's snake or high-pressure water. |
| Look for Leaks | Month-to-month | Search for drips or pools around downpipes. |
| Examine for Corrosion | Each year | Particularly for older metal pipes. |
| Change Hangers | As required | Ensure pipes are appropriately protected. |
| Examine Drainage Flow | After heavy rain | Look for slow drain or pooling. |
4. Indications Your Downpipes Need Attention
Being proactive about downpipe maintenance is essential. Here are some signs that your downpipes might need immediate attention:
Water Pooling: If water gathers around the base of the structure after it rains, it indicates an obstruction or insufficient drain.
Noticeable Damage: Check for cracks, rust, or signs of wear and tear on the pipelines.
Mold or Mildew: If mold appears near the downpipes, it might signify water overflow.
Unpleasant Odors: Foul smells can indicate stagnant water or raw material caught in the downpipe system.
Insect Activity: Mosquitoes and other pests can breed in stagnant water, increasing throughout heavy rains.
